Spokesman for the Iranian Foreign Ministry Bahram Qasemi announced that the Danish ambassador to Tehran has been summoned on an attack on Iran’s Embassy in Copenhagen, IRNA reported on Thursday.
Qasemi said the Danish envoy was ordered to go to the Foreign Ministry after six people from opposition groups attacked the Iranian Embassy in Copenhagen on Wednesday afternoon.

Iran's Foreign Ministry on Friday condemned recent deadly terror attack in Pakistan as a "brutal and savage" act.
In a statement, the Foreign Ministry Spokesman Bahram Qasemi offered his condolences to the Pakistani people and government and the families of victims.
